Excel Template Efficiency Guide: Build Your Reusable Template Library

Turning recurring reports into reusable templates saves significant time:Step 1: Identify high-frequency scenariosList monthly reports (attendance, sales, expenses) worth templating.Step 2: Standardize structureFix headers and formula areas; leave only input zones;Use dropdown validation to reduce input errors;Protect key formulas.Step 3: Version controlStore templates separately with version names.Step 4: Use conditional formatting and chartsCharts update automatically as data changes.Our store offers Excel templates for finance, HR and project management.

Icon Asset Buying Guide: Vector Formats and Licensing

Icons are essential for UI design and presentations. Three points when buying:1. File formatSVG: vector, scales without quality loss, works on web and PPT — first choice;PNG: bitmap, ready to use but limited scaling;AI/EPS: professional formats for further editing.2. Style consistencyBuy sets with unified style (outline/filled/skeuomorphic) to keep interfaces coherent.3. LicensingConfirm whether the license covers your scenario (in-app, web use, etc.).

How to Choose a Resume Template: Layout and Content Tips

Your resume is the first impression for recruiters. Template tips:LayoutKeep it to one page (two at most);Order: education, experience, projects, skills — adjust by target role;Avoid flashy colors; black/white/gray plus one accent color is safest;Make sure the docx opens correctly in mainstream Office versions.ContentQuantify results with numbers;Tailor keywords for each position.Our store's Document Templates category offers resume templates across industries.

Font Licensing Guide: Using Fonts Commercially Without Infringement

Font infringement is a common risk in design. Confirm licensing before commercial use:License typesFree personal, paid commercial: the most common model;Free commercial: open fonts can be used freely under their licenses;Per-use licensing: print, web embedding, app embedding and video subtitles may require separate licenses.TipsVerify license status on the foundry's official site before commercial use;Keep purchase receipts and license files;When unsure, use fonts explicitly marked as free for commercial use.

Business PPT Template Buying Guide: Avoid These Pitfalls

A good PPT template saves time, but watch out for these pitfalls:Format incompatibility: confirm the template version (pptx recommended) matches your Office/WPS;Missing fonts: templates with special fonts may break; prefer those using common fonts;Hard-to-replace placeholders: check that standard placeholders are used;Unclear commercial license: for business use, confirm the commercial usage scope.Define your scenario first (annual report / pitch / thesis defense), then pick a matching style.
